Mrunal Thakur and Dhanush’s dating rumours have been hitting the headlines since the last few months. The speculations first surfaced in August 2025 after the actress was seen warmly greeting the Tamil
star at the premiere of her film Son Of Sardaar 2. Now, in a recent interview, she called herself a ‘big fan’ of the Raanjhanaa actor, stating that she wishes to work with him in the future. She also recalled inviting him for the screening of Son Of Sardaar 2, revealing that she was so happy when he showed up.
Mrunal Thakur On Inviting Dhanush For Son Of Sardaar 2 Screening
Mrunal Thakur, who has been promoting her film Do Deewane Seher Mein, recently called herself a huge fan of Dhanush. While speaking with Mirchi Plus, she said, “After watching Raayan, Maari, Raanjhanaa, Captain Miller, I am a big, big fan of him. Asuran too. I can watch it multiple times. And he is such an institution and it takes so much for an actor to take out that performance from other actors too. So he is a fantastic lyricist, writer, dancer, actor, director, what not.”
She further revealed that she invited him to the screening of her film ‘Son Of Sardaar 2’ while he was shooting for Tere Ishk Mein. “It so happened that while he was shooting for Tere Ishk Mein, I just was like ‘Sir, can you please come for the screening of Son Of Sardaar?’ I didn’t know he would come. And he just came and I was so happy. I was like this is really sweet. And I really wish to work with him one day,” she said.
Mrunal Thakur And Dhanush’s Wedding Rumours
Mrunal’s wedding rumours with Dhanush have also been making headlines since the last few weeks. While several media reports recently claimed that the two actors are likely to tie the knot soon, Thakur recently dismissed all speculations. She was speaking to Hindustan Times when she laughed off the rumours and shared, “Woh to shaadi ho rahi hai (The wedding is taking place) according to them.”
Further, when asked if these rumours affect her in any way, Mrunal added, “Up until now, I didn’t have a PR team. I had to hire a team to sort things out because my home address was out in public. To protect myself, I had to hire a team. But I have realised that even if I spend ₹3 crore, ₹6 crore, ₹10 crore, itni publicity mujhe kabhi nahi milegi (I would never get such publicity). So, a big thank you to everybody who has been spreading fake rumours.”
